The 4% rule is a starting point, not a law. What actually decides the outcome is the gap between your return and inflation — and whether you can flex spending in bad years.

About this calculator
The question behind every retirement plan is whether the money outlasts you. This calculator runs a year-by-year simulation: your portfolio grows at your assumed return, your withdrawal rises with inflation, and the balance either survives the horizon or runs out — and it tells you the year. It also reports the 4% rule figure and the maximum inflation-adjusted withdrawal your horizon can actually support.

FAQ
What is the 4% rule?
It comes from the Trinity Study: withdraw 4% of your portfolio in the first year of retirement, then increase that dollar amount with inflation each year. Across historical 30-year US windows, that pace rarely exhausted a balanced portfolio. It's a planning benchmark, not a guarantee.
How much can I safely withdraw in retirement?
It depends on your horizon, asset mix, and flexibility. Longer retirements and bond-heavy portfolios support less; a willingness to cut spending in down years supports more. Many planners now cite a range of roughly 3.3% to 4.5% rather than a single number.
What is sequence of returns risk?
The risk that poor market returns arrive early in retirement, while your balance is largest. Selling into a decline to fund withdrawals permanently shrinks the base. Holding one to three years of spending in cash or short bonds is the common defense.
Should I withdraw from taxable, traditional, or Roth accounts first?
The conventional order is taxable first, then traditional, then Roth — but blending is often better. Filling the low brackets with traditional withdrawals in your early retirement years reduces the RMDs that would otherwise force you into a higher bracket later.
Accuracy and limitations
- Results are estimates before tax, fees, and inflation unless an input explicitly covers them.
- Rates are treated as fixed for the whole period — variable-rate products will drift from this projection.
- This is educational maths, not financial advice. Check anything contractual with the lender or your accountant.
